URL zum Verfassen einer Nachricht in Google Mail (mit vollständiger Google Mail-Oberfläche und angegeben für, bcc, Betreff usw.)


86

Ich habe einen Beitrag gefunden , der ein Beispiel für einen Link enthält, der nur ein Fenster zum Verfassen von Nachrichten öffnet. Ich möchte jedoch, dass ein Fenster mit der vollständigen Google Mail-Oberfläche geöffnet wird , aber bereit ist, eine neue Nachricht zu verfassen.

Das funktioniert natürlich:

https://mail.google.com/mail/u/0/#compose

Aber ich möchte auch ein Thema hinzufügen, zu, bcc usw. Ich habe etwas wie das Folgende versucht, aber ohne Erfolg:

https://mail.google.com/mail/?to=inbox@example.com&bcc=admin@example.com&subject=Hey#compose

Irgendwelche Ideen? Vielen Dank.


Die URL aus der Antwort unten scheint nicht zu funktionieren. Haben Sie einen Weg gefunden, dies zu erreichen?
Alkar

Gibt es eine Möglichkeit, das Mail-Fenster so zu öffnen, als ob es auf eine URL antwortet oder diese weiterleitet? Damit Benutzer direkt weiterleiten oder auf E-Mails antworten können.
Kartik Domadiya

@Kartik, ich habe eine ähnliche Frage erstellt hier . Leider noch keine Antworten. Wissen Sie, wie Sie das erreichen können?
Daniel Marín

Antworten:


157

1
Was ist mit einer Version für Google Apps? Irgendwelche Ideen?
Cronoklee

2
Wissen Sie, wie Sie den from-Parameter einstellen? Ich habe in meinem Google Mail-Konto mehrere Konten zur Auswahl beim Senden ... und ich möchte in der Lage sein, ein gewünschtes über den URL-Parameter
DS_web_developer

1
Hat jemand eine Idee von anderen Diensten, die diesen Ansatz anbieten? Yahoo, Outlook, MSN?
Sunny R Gupta

5
@cronoklee Ich weiß, es ist alt, aber vielleicht könnte jemand es verwenden ... für Google Apps verwenden Sie mail.google.com/a/domain.com/mail?view=cm ...
apprenticeDev

1
@floribon Oh richtig, das ist noch einfacher :) durch +die verschlüsselte URL ersetzen %2B- mail.google.com/mail/…
nxasdf

23

Wenn Sie diese URL mit einem Lesezeichen versehen, erhalten Sie ein Vollbild-Kompositionsfenster ohne Ablenkungen:

https://mail.google.com/mail/?view=cm&fs=1&tf=1

Wenn Sie zukunftssicher sein möchten (siehe beispielsweise, wie andere URLs in dieser Frage nicht mehr funktionieren), können Sie einen Link mit einem Lesezeichen versehen zu:

mailto:

Daraufhin wird Ihr Standard-E-Mail-Client geöffnet, und Sie haben Google Mail wahrscheinlich bereits für diesen Zweck konfiguriert.


1
Perfekt, wenn Sie jemandem eine kurze Nachricht senden möchten, ohne Ihren Posteingang zu durchsuchen!
Volodymyr

1
Ich danke dir sehr! Genau das habe ich gesucht: Eine ablenkungsfreie Möglichkeit, eine E-Mail zu senden - nur ein Blick auf den Posteingang zieht Sie an. Ich wünschte, ich könnte mehr als einmal abstimmen!
GraehamF

1
mailto:Link ist Gold!
Nealmcb

Das ist toll. Ich konnte meiner Taskleiste eine Verknüpfung hinzufügen, die diese öffnet, und sie funktioniert hervorragend. "C:\Program Files (x86)\Google\Chrome\Application\chrome.exe" --app="https://mail.google.com/mail/?view=cm&fs=1&tf=1"
IMTheNachoMan

8

https://mail.google.com/mail/u/0/x/?&v=b&eot=1&pv=tl&cs=b

Dieser Link dient zum direkten Erstellen in m.gmail.com als mobil in einem Desktop-Browser. Warum? Es ist wirklich schneller.


Der Link funktioniert und ist schnell. aber nicht als angefordertes OP, das bcc und cc auch über die URL vorab ausfüllen kann. Es hätte es auch großartig gemacht, wenn es eine Datei mit einer normalen HTML-Eingabetypdatei anhängen könnte.
IsmailS

7

Der GMail-Webclient unterstützt mailto:Links

Für regelmäßige @gmail.com Konten:https://mail.google.com/mail/?extsrc=mailto&url=...

Für G Suite-Konten in der Domain gsuitedomain.com:https://mail.google.com/a/gsuitedomain.com/mail/?extsrc=mailto&url=...

...muss durch eine urlencodierte ersetzt werden mailto: Link ersetzt werden.

Demo: https://mail.google.com/mail/?extsrc=mailto&url=mailto%3A%3Fto%3Dsomeguy%40gmail.com%26bcc%3Dmyattorney%40gmail.com%2Cbuzzfeed%40gmail.com%26subject%3DHi%2520There % 26body% 3Dbody% 2520goes% 2520here

Weitere mailto:Informationen zu Links finden Sie in RFC6068


1
Vielen Dank, dass Sie eine Quelle und einen RFC angegeben haben! Ich habe jedoch festgestellt, dass Google Mail und RFC in einer Hinsicht unterschiedlich sind: Google Mail verwendet su=, RFC verwendet subject=. Ansonsten erscheinen sie identisch. RFC 2368 war ebenfalls nützlich.
HoldOffHunger

7

Es ist erwähnenswert, dass Sie bei mehreren Google Mail-Konten möglicherweise den URL-Ansatz verwenden möchten, da Sie anpassen können, aus welchem ​​Konto Sie erstellen möchten.

z.B

https://mail.google.com/mail/u/0/#inbox?compose=new   
https://mail.google.com/mail/u/1/#inbox?compose=new

Wenn Sie die E-Mail-Adresse kennen, von der Sie senden, ersetzen Sie den numerischen Index durch die E-Mail-Adresse:

https://mail.google.com/mail/u/your@email.com/#inbox?compose=new

1
Wie kann man die Tatsache umgehen, dass dies von der Reihenfolge abhängt, in der Sie sich in jedem Konto angemeldet haben?
Matt

7
@Matt Ja, Sie können anstelle des numerischen Index mail.google.com/mail/u/your@email.com/#inbox?compose=new verwenden.
Eivind Eklund

5

Für Chrome:

  1. Stellen Sie Ihren E-Mail-Manager auf Google Mail ein

Google Mail-Handler

  1. Schreiben Sie mailto: in die Adressleiste und drücken Sie die Eingabetaste.

Einfacher:

  1. Suchmaschinen bearbeiten:

Suchmaschinen bearbeiten

Suchmaschinen bearbeiten

  1. Schreiben Sie mt und geben Sie es in die Adressleiste ein.

Netter Hack! ThaTsat ist eine Niteresting-Methode
Jesse

1

Viele andere haben hier hervorragende Arbeit geleistet und vor allem eine grundlegende Antwort gegeben Tobias Mühl . Wie bereits erwähnt, entspricht die API von GMail sehr genau der Definition von RFC2368 und RFC6068 . Dies gilt für die erweiterte Form der mailto: -Links, aber auch für die häufig verwendeten Formen, die in den anderen Antworten enthalten sind. Von den fünf Parametern sind vier identische (wie to, cc, bccund body) und eine nur geringe Änderung erhalten ( sudie Version des gmail von subject).

Wenn Sie mehr darüber erfahren möchten, was Sie mit mailTo- Google Mail-URLs tun können , können diese RFCs hilfreich sein. Leider hat Google selbst keine Quelle veröffentlicht.

So klären Sie die Parameter:

  • to - E-Mail an wen
  • su(gmail API) / subject(mailTo API) - E-Mail-Titel
  • body - Nachrichtentext
  • bcc - E-Mail Blind-Carbon Copy
  • cc - E-Mail-Adresse

-1

Die obigen Beispiel-URLs für Standard-Google Mail geben einen Google-Fehler zurück.

Der Beitrag vom Februar 2014 zum Thread 2583928 empfiehlt das Ersetzen view=cm&fs=1&tf=1durch&v=b&cs=wh .

Hinweis: Es scheint auch nicht mehr möglich zu sein, den E-Mail-Text automatisch zu füllen.


März 2020: Ich kann den E-Mail-Text problemlos ausfüllen.
Tony O'Hagan

-1

Wenn Sie in Google Mail auf "E-Mail verfassen" klicken, beachten Sie, dass sich die URL von https://mail.google.com/mail/u/0/#inbox zu https://mail.google.com/mail/u/0/# ändert Posteingang? compose = new . Wenn Sie nun beispielsweise eine E-Mail-ID xyz@gmail.com eingeben, ändert sich der Wert für "Verfassen". Die URL lautet nun " https://mail.google.com/mail/u/0/#inbox?compose=150b0f7ffb682642" .

Das funktioniert also gut mit meinem HTML-Hyperlink, bis das Konto angemeldet ist. Wenn das Konto jedoch nicht angemeldet ist, wird die Anmeldeseite aufgerufen. Wenn ich die Anmeldeinformationen eingebe, geht dieser Erstellungswert irgendwie verloren und funktioniert nicht.


1
150b0f7ffb682642ist die ID Ihres E-Mail-Entwurfs. Dieser Link funktioniert nur, wenn Sie in Ihrem Google Mail-Konto angemeldet sind. Andere Leute, die auf den Link klicken, sehen das nicht xyz@gmail.comals Empfänger
Tobias Mühl
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.